Ali Asgari
Ali Asgari (born 25 July, 1982; Tehran) is an Iranian director, screenwriter and producer. He studied film in Italy and is an alumnus of the 2013 Berlinale Talent Campus. His short films have screened at over 600 film festivals around the world including Sundance, London and Melbourne, and won more than 150 international awards. His feature film Disappearance was developed at the Cinéfondation La Résidence of the Cannes International Film Festival. He is a member of the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ences.
